The Nokia 150 (2020), identified by the model number TA-1235, is a popular feature phone that occasionally requires software maintenance to fix issues like boot loops, display flickering, or "Contact Service" errors. This guide covers how to use the Nokia TA-1235 Flash File with the Miracle Box software to restore your device to factory settings. Understanding the Nokia TA-1235 (Nokia 150 2020)

Before flashing, ensure your device matches these core specifications to avoid using the wrong firmware: Processor: MediaTek (MTK) chipset. Display: 2.4-inch QVGA (240 x 320 px). Memory: 4 MB RAM and 4 MB Internal Storage. OS: Series 30+. Prerequisites for Flashing

To successfully flash your Nokia TA-1235 using Miracle Box, you will need the following components:

Flash File: A clean stock firmware (bin or nb0 format) specific to the TA-1235 model.

Miracle Box/Thunder: The service tool used to write the firmware to the device.

MTK USB Drivers: Essential for the PC to recognize the phone in flash mode. Hardware: A high-quality micro-USB cable and a PC. How to Flash Nokia TA-1235 via Miracle Box

Follow these steps to repair software-related issues on your device:

Driver Installation: Install the latest MediaTek USB VCOM Drivers on your computer to ensure stable connectivity.

Open Miracle Box: Launch the Miracle Box or Miracle Thunder software on your PC. nokia ta-1235 flash file miracle box

Select Chipset: Navigate to the MTK tab within the software.

Set Service Type: Choose the Write option. In the model dropdown, select the appropriate boot (often "Automatic" or "4th Boot" for newer feature phones).

Load Flash File: Click the folder icon to browse and select your downloaded Nokia TA-1235 Flash File (typically a .bin or .nb0 file). Connect Device:

Power off the phone and remove the battery once, then reinsert it. Click the Start button in Miracle Box.

Hold the Boot Key (usually the '0' key or the Dial key) and connect the phone to the PC via USB cable.

Flashing Process: Once detected, the software will begin writing the firmware. Wait until you see a "Write OK" message. Common Issues Fixed by Flashing

Dead Boot/No Power: Fixes devices that won't turn on due to corrupted software.

Display Issues: Resolves blinking keypad lights with no screen display. Security Lock: Removes forgotten PIN or privacy locks.

Hang on Logo: Repairs devices stuck on the Nokia startup screen.

Warning: Flashing will erase all user data on the device. Ensure the battery is charged to at least 50% before starting to prevent an accidental shutdown during the process. Nokia 150 2020 TA-1235 technical specifications

The Nokia 150 (2020), model TA-1235, is a popular feature phone based on the MediaTek chipset architecture. Repairing this device often requires specialized tools like Miracle Box (or Miracle Thunder) to resolve issues such as a blinking keypad light, white screen, or a "dead" boot state. Key Flashing Information for TA-1235

When using Miracle Box to flash this device, keep the following technical details in mind:

CPU Type: The TA-1235 uses a MediaTek (MTK) processor. In Miracle Box, you must select the MTK tab to proceed with flashing or formatting.

Boot Key: For many Nokia MTK feature phones, the boot key is typically the "0" key, the dial key, or the menu key. You must hold this key while connecting the USB cable for the PC to recognize the device. The Nokia TA-1235 Go to product viewer dialog

File Format: Firmware files for these devices often come in .bin or .nb0 formats. Ensure you have a "tested" flash file to avoid further software corruption. Step-by-Step Flashing Guide with Miracle Box

Preparation: Download the correct Nokia TA-1235 Flash File and install the necessary MTK USB Drivers on your PC. Tool Setup: Launch Miracle Box and navigate to the MTK tab. Operation Selection: To fix a dead phone, choose Write.

To remove a lock or fix a hang-on-logo, you might try Format first.

Loading Firmware: Click the folder icon to select your downloaded .bin or .nb0 flash file. Connection: Turn off the phone and remove/reinsert the battery. Click Start in Miracle Box.

Hold the Boot Key and connect the phone to the PC via a high-quality USB cable.

Completion: Once the progress bar reaches 100% and displays "Write OK," disconnect the phone and power it on. Common Issues Solved by Flashing

Keypad Light Blinking: Often caused by a corrupted OS where the screen remains dark but the keys light up.

Stuck on Logo: The device fails to boot past the initial "Nokia" screen.

Dead After Wrong File: Using an incompatible firmware version can "brick" the device, requiring a factory-tested file to restore it.
